The SuperOne Championship continues this weekend at Clay Pigeon with Rounds 5 and 6.

Clay has long been one of the most recognisable circuits on the calendar. The high speed nature of the layout rewards drivers who can maintain momentum without scrubbing speed. Overtaking opportunities are available, but racecraft and consistency often prove just as important as outright pace.

With two complete rounds taking place across Saturday and Sunday, every qualifying session, heat and final carries championship significance. Strong performances across both days will be key as the season enters its next phase.

The team head back to Whilton Mill this weekend for WMKC Round 3, with the club championship continuing to take shape.

Whilton’s layout places a unique demand on drivers. The constant elevation changes combined with the uneven surface mean maintaining rhythm is never straightforward, and small mistakes can quickly cost time across a lap. Drivers who stay composed through the bumps and remain consistent over a race distance are usually the ones who move forward.

With qualifying taking place on Saturday before a full race day on Sunday, building strong track position early in the weekend will be key to shaping the final outcome.

The British Kart Championships continue this weekend at Shenington, with KZ2 once again taking centre stage at the highest level of UK karting.

Shenington presents a different challenge to many circuits on the calendar. The high-speed nature of the layout rewards bravery and precision, while the tighter technical sections demand discipline under braking and strong kart control. In KZ2, where the speed and intensity increase even further, staying consistent across a race distance becomes critical.

With another competitive field expected, every session across the weekend will carry importance as the championship battle continues to develop.
